Xcode 6.5:开发者的新利器
Xcode 6.5:开发者的新利器
Xcode 是苹果公司为开发者提供的集成开发环境(IDE),用于开发 iOS、macOS、watchOS 和 tvOS 应用。随着技术的不断进步,苹果公司在 Xcode 6.5 版本中引入了许多新功能和改进,使其成为开发者手中的新利器。本文将详细介绍 Xcode 6.5 的新特性、相关应用以及如何利用这些新功能提升开发效率。
新功能与改进
Xcode 6.5 带来了以下几项显著的改进:
-
Swift 5.5 支持:Xcode 6.5 支持最新的 Swift 5.5,这意味着开发者可以使用最新的语言特性,如异步函数(async/await)、属性包装器(property wrappers)等,极大地简化了异步编程的复杂性。
-
性能优化:新版本在编译速度和调试性能上进行了优化,减少了编译时间,提高了开发效率。特别是在大型项目中,编译时间的缩短尤为显著。
-
界面构建器(Interface Builder)改进:Xcode 6.5 增强了 Interface Builder 的功能,支持更多的视图和控件的拖放式设计,简化了用户界面的设计过程。
-
测试和调试工具:新增了更强大的测试工具和调试功能,如改进的内存泄漏检测、更直观的线程调试界面等,帮助开发者更快地发现和修复问题。
-
源代码控制:Xcode 6.5 改进了与 Git 和 SVN 的集成,提供了更好的版本控制体验,方便团队协作。
相关应用
Xcode 6.5 适用于多种开发场景,以下是一些典型的应用:
-
iOS 应用开发:无论是原生应用还是混合应用,Xcode 6.5 都提供了强大的开发工具和框架支持,如 UIKit、SwiftUI 等。
-
macOS 应用开发:开发者可以利用 Xcode 6.5 开发桌面应用,利用 AppKit 或 Catalyst 框架快速构建跨平台应用。
-
watchOS 和 tvOS 应用:Xcode 6.5 支持最新的 watchOS 和 tvOS 开发,提供了相应的模拟器和调试工具。
-
游戏开发:结合 SpriteKit 和 SceneKit,开发者可以利用 Xcode 6.5 开发高性能的游戏。
-
企业级应用:对于需要高效开发和维护的企业应用,Xcode 6.5 的新功能可以显著提高开发效率和代码质量。
如何利用 Xcode 6.5 提升开发效率
-
学习新特性:开发者应花时间学习 Swift 5.5 的新特性,特别是异步编程,这将大大简化代码结构。
-
利用自动化测试:Xcode 6.5 提供了更好的测试工具,开发者应充分利用这些工具进行单元测试和UI测试,确保代码质量。
-
优化项目结构:利用 Xcode 6.5 的新功能,重新审视和优化项目结构,减少编译时间,提高代码可读性。
-
团队协作:利用改进的源代码控制功能,确保团队成员之间的协作更加顺畅,减少冲突和错误。
-
持续学习:苹果公司定期发布更新和新功能,开发者需要保持学习,及时更新自己的知识库。
总之,Xcode 6.5 作为苹果开发工具链中的重要一环,为开发者提供了更强大的功能和更高的效率。无论你是初学者还是经验丰富的开发者,都可以通过学习和使用 Xcode 6.5 来提升自己的开发能力,创造出更优秀的应用。希望本文能为你提供有价值的信息,助力你的开发之旅。